did about 35 miles, mostly highway avg 70-75mph and pulled into my driveway with 26.9mpg. (stock tires '24 TRD Off-Road). Temps were around 65 to 70 degrees, elevation 1700-2000ft above sea level, and I was not being light footed either as I was trying to hear the turbo spool up when accelerating. I also was in normal mode, not eco or sport.

@@timalan7406 did about 320 miles this weekend on a road trip to the overlanding expo, went from Phoenix to Flagstaff (1000ft to 6800ft) and got an avg mpg of 23 with avg speed of 75-80 (speed limit on the 17 is mostly 75 with some sections dropping to 60 for the hill curves). Mpg was 20.9 up and 25 down giving me the 23 avg.
